About

Experience the magic of Christmas By The Sea in Blackpool, a spectacular festive village returning for 2024. Delight in free ice skating, enchanting light projections on The Blackpool Tower, and simulated snowfalls. Explore themed cabins for gifts and treats, and enjoy thrilling rides like the Star Flyer. The event extends the famous Blackpool Illuminations, creating a truly dazzling winter wonderland.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the opening dates for Christmas By The Sea?

The village is open from Friday, November 15, 2024, to Sunday, January 5, 2025.

Is there an entry fee for the Christmas By The Sea village?

Many attractions, including the skating rink, projection shows, and light installations, are free to access.

What are the operating hours for the attractions?

The village, chalets, and fairground rides are generally open daily from 12 pm to 9 pm. Snowfalls occur on the hour from 6 pm to 10 pm, and Tower projection shows run nightly from 6 pm to 10 pm.

Is there parking available?

Yes, there is a special offer of ยฃ2 for four hours of parking at many Blackpool Council car parks during the event season.

Are there any New Year's Eve celebrations?

Yes, a free family celebration with a Bavarian band, fireworks, and a projection show takes place on New Year's Eve from 3 pm to 6 pm.
